The Assessing Office is responsible for identifying and valuing all real property within Cass County. Once values are certified by the State Board of Equalization, they are sent to the Finance Office to calculate property taxes.
The County Recorder is the land records officer for the county and is an appointed position. The Recorder’s office is responsible for recording, preserving, and providing public access to Cass County real estate documents.
